WebThus for laminar flow of a Newtonian fluid in a pipe the momentum flow rate is greater by a factor of 4/3 than it would be if the same fluid with the same mass flow rate had a uniform velocity. This difference is analogous to the different values of α in Bernoulli's equation ( equation 1.14 ). WebMomentum equation: in general fluid mechanics, this equation is expressed as Newton’s law. It is the expression describing the relationship of the force applied onto the fluid unit … WebThe Navier–Stokes equations are strictly a statement of the balance of momentum. To fully describe fluid flow, more information is needed, how much depending on the assumptions made. This additional information may include boundary data (no-slip, capillary surface, etc.), conservation of mass, balance of energy, and/or an equation of state.
